Drainage Sloping in Houston, TX
Drainage sloping services involve adjusting the gradient of a property's landscape to ensure proper water runoff away from the foundation, walkways, and other structures. This service typically covers projects such as grading yards, installing or improving drainage swales, and ensuring existing slopes direct water efficiently. Property owners often seek drainage sloping to prevent water pooling, reduce the risk of basement flooding, and protect landscaping by guiding rainwater away from critical areas.
Before requesting drainage sloping, property owners usually want to understand the current slope conditions, the amount of water flow during heavy rains, and any existing drainage issues. It is important to consider the property's layout, soil type, and local drainage regulations to determine the most effective slope adjustments. Proper assessment and planning can help ensure that the drainage system works effectively, minimizing water-related concerns and maintaining the integrity of the landscape.

Drainage Sloping Questions
What is drainage sloping? Drainage sloping involves adjusting the ground surface to direct water away from buildings and foundations, helping prevent water accumulation and damage.
Why is proper drainage sloping important? Correct slope ensures water flows away efficiently, reducing the risk of basement flooding, foundation issues, and landscape erosion.
What types of projects typically require drainage sloping? Common projects include yard grading, driveway drainage, patio leveling, and foundation waterproofing preparations.
How does drainage sloping improve property safety? It minimizes standing water and runoff, decreasing slip hazards and preventing water-related structural problems.
